What is remote airlines engineering?

Remote airlines engineering refers to the practice of managing, maintaining, and troubleshooting airline systems, aircraft, and related technologies from a location away from the physical aircraft or airport. These professionals use digital tools, remote monitoring systems, and communication technologies to ensure the safety, efficiency, and reliability of airline operations. Remote airlines engineers can work on tasks like software updates, system diagnostics, and supporting on-site technicians, all while minimizing the need for in-person intervention. With advancements in technology, this role has become increasingly important for cost savings, operational flexibility, and global airline support.

What are the common challenges faced by engineers working remotely in the airline industry?

Engineers working remotely in the airline industry often encounter challenges such as coordinating effectively across time zones, maintaining secure access to sensitive systems, and staying updated with rapidly evolving safety regulations. Communication can require extra effort, especially when collaborating with on-site teams or responding to urgent technical issues. However, many companies use advanced collaboration tools and regular virtual meetings to help ensure seamless teamwork and project progress.

The California Independent System Operator (ISO) manages the flow of electricity across the high-voltage, long-distance power lines that make up 80 percent of California's power grid. We safeguard the economy and well-being of 30 million Californians by operating the grid reliably 24/7.
As the impartial grid operator, the California ISO opens access to the wholesale power market that is designed to diversify resources and lower prices. It also grants equal access to 25,865 circuit-miles of power lines and reduces barriers to diverse resources competing to bring power to customers.
The California ISO's function is often compared to that of air traffic controllers. It would be grossly unfair for air traffic controllers to represent one airline and profit from allowing that company's planes to go through before others. In the same way, the California ISO operates independently-managing the electron traffic on a power grid we do not own-making sure electricity is safely delivered to utilities and consumers on time and reliably.
